Nice mower but I have some tips for you:
1. Don’t leave the choke for so long when you start it and use it while in choke.
2. You don’t need to choke it back up when the engine is warm.
3. Don’t shut off the engine at high throttle because it can backfire.
4. No need to put it on choke when you turn it off.

The lever below the throttle is to control the speed. By and large you want the engine throttle up all the way (rabbit) when moving or cutting. Use the gear lever to adjust your speed.
